Ukuran perusahaan memiliki pengaruh positif signifikan sementara itu pertumbuhan kontribusi, hasil investasi, dan likuiditas menunjukkan tidak adanya pengaruh terhadap solvabilitas Asuransi Jiwa Syariah di Indonesia periode 2015-2019.Kata Kunci: Ukuran Perusahaan, Pertumbuhan Kontribusi, Hasil Investasi, Likuiditas, Solvabilitas, Asuransi Jiwa Syariah. ABSTRACTThe purpose of this study isto determine whether there is an effect of company size, premium growth, investment returns, and liquidity on solvency as proxied by Risk Based Capital on sharia life insurance in Indonesia partially or simultaneously. Determination of the sample by purposive sampling method found 10 sample companies. With the help of Eviews9 application through the panel data regression test, it is obtained the equation RBC = -563.8638 + 44.05145 Size + 1.922926 Contribution - 0.333289 Investment + 0.911149 Liquidity + e. The results showed that the four variables together affect solvency. Company size has a significant positive effect meanwhile the premium growth, investment returns, and liquidity shows no influence on the solvency of sharia life insurance in Indonesia period 2015-2019.Keywords: Company Size, Premium Growth, Investment Return, Liquidity, Solvency, Sharia Life Insurance.

Dengan nilai Adjusted R2 menunjukkan hasil senilai 0.941663 yang artinya 94%, sedangkan sisanya 6% dipengaruhi oleh variabel lain diluar penelitian ini.  Kata kunci: Surplus Underwriting Dana Tabarru’, Asuransi Jiwa Syariah, Regresi Data Panel ABSTRACTThe purpose of this study is to analyze the effect of net income, claims, investment returns, and sharia reinsurance on the underwriting surplus of tabarru funds in Islamic life insurance companies for the period 2014-2019. This research used a quantitative method approach with panel data regression analysis unit. The data used in this research is secondary data, using purposive sampling method. The data used by researchers is the financial statements of sharia life insurance companies for the period 2014-2019, which can assess 15 samples of sharia life insurance companies registered in the Financial Services Authority. Partially the results of the research findings which are applied through the Net Contribution variable, have a significant positive effect, Claims have a significant negative effect, while investment returns and Sharia Reinsurance have no significant effect on the tabarru 'underwriting fund surplus. Simultaneously Net Contribution, Claims, Investment Results, Sharia Reinsurance have a significant effect on the tabarru fund underwriting surplus with a significant level of 0.000 <0.05. With the Adjusted R2 value shows the calculation result of 0.941663, which means 94%, while the remaining 6%, other variables are outside this study.Keyword: Surplus Underwriting Tabarru’ Fund, Sharia Life Insurance, Panel Data Regression

This researcher examines how thin capitalization, profitability, and company size affect tax avoidance. The sample used is manufacturing compan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ange for the period 2017 to 2019. The sampling method uses purposive sampling in order to obtain 69 manufacturing companies. This study uses panel data regression analysis techniques with the help of the Eviews 10. This study shows that the independent variable thin capitalization has no effect on tax avoidance. While profitability has a significant positive effect on tax avoidance, and company size has a significant negative effect on tax avoidance.

ABSTRACTThis study aims to analyze the effect of proportion of  independent commissioner and executive’s compensation on tax aggressiveness. This research uses quantitative method by using panel data regression analysis. The population in this research is all financial sectors firm listed in the Indonesia Stock Exchange in the year 2014 - 2017. The sample was selected by using purposive sampling method and acquired 59 firms and 236 observations. The result of this study indicates that executive’s compensation has negative effect on tax aggressiveness. This study aims to determine the analysis of factors affect the capital structure of registered textile and garment companies on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) for the 2014-2016 period. Variables in this study namely Profitability (ROA), Asset Structure (SA), Sales Growth (PP) and Company Size (SIZE) and Capital Structure (DER). The population in this study is the Textile and Garment company list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) as many as 17 companies later 15 companies were sampled using a purposive technique sampling. The analysis technique used is panel data regression analysis with comparison of t-statistics with t-tables. The results of this study indicate that profitability (ROA) is not positive effect on Capital Structure (DER), t-statistic of 1.386407. Asset Structure (SA) has no positive effect on Capital Structure (DER), statistic equal to 0.296574. Sales Growth (PP) influences positive for Capital Structure (DER), the statistic is 1.873566. Size The company (SIZE) does not have a positive effect on the Capital Structure (DER), statistic at 0.570955.

This study examines and analyzes the factors that influence capital structure.  Independent variables in this study are company size, liquidity, profitability and asset structure.  The population in this study are mining compan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ange for the 2015-2018 period.  The sample selection technique uses purposive sampling and 12 company samples are obtained within a period of 4 years so that 48 company samples are obtained.  The data analysis method used in this study is panel data regression.  Hypothesis testing is done using the t test and the F test. The panel data regression test results show that simultaneously company size, liquidity, profitability and asset structure have an influence on capital structure.  While partially the variables that significantly influence the capital structure are company size.  While the liquidity, profitability and asset structure variables do not significantly affect the capital structure.

This study aims to examine how much influence Financial Distress, company size, and Leverage have on Audit Delay with Auditor Reputation as a Moderating Variable in All Manufacturing Companies List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) for the 2015-2019 Period. Sampling in the study using the method of purposive sampling obtained 32 companies with a research period of 5 years. The analytical method used in this study is panel data regression analysis with Fixed Effect estimation results using Eviews 9. The results showed that financial distress partially had a positive effect, company size partially had a positive and significant effect on audit delay, while leverage had a positive effect on audit delay.

This research aims to test the company's size, profitability and audit opinion on audit delay in the mining and mineral sector in IDX. This study used samples in the mining and mineral sector in IDX 2013-2019. Based on purposive sampling, the number of mining and mineral companies used in the research sample is as many as 9 companies. Hypothetical testing using panel data regression using the E Views 8.0 program. The results showed that the size of the company had a significant positive effect on audit delay, profitability had no effect on audit delay and audit opinion had a significant negative effect on audit delay.

This research is an analysis on Sharia Rural Banking (BPRS) Listed on Otoritas Jasa Keuangan website (www.ojk.go.id) during Year 2012 – 2015. The research entitled “Analysis variables that influence Murabahah Financing and influence to Return on Asset (Study on Sharia Rural Banking  on Indonesia during Year 2012 – 2015)”. The purpose of this research is to analyze the influence of non performing financing, wadiah savings, financing to deposit ratio, operating expenses operating income toward murabahah financing and influence to return on asset. This research used panel data regression analysis as model to test the hypothesis. The population in this research was Sharia Rural Banking (BPRS) on Indonesia during Year 2012 – 2015 consisting of 168 banks. While the samples of this research were taken by purposive sampling method which were 25 banks. The result of this research showed that: (1) non performing financing has no effect toward murabahah financing, (2) wadiah savings had positive effect toward murabahah financing, (3) financing to deposit ratio has no effect toward murabahah financing, (4 operating expenses operating income had negative effect toward murabahah financing, (5 murabahah financing had positive effect toward return on asset. Implication based on result of this research was the management need to increase wadiah savings and need to decrease operating expenses operating income because it can increase the murabahah financing. The management also needs to increase murabahah financing, because it is in this research is proven to increase the return on asset.
